### Release Checklist — Item 7: Static-Analysis Baseline

Regenerate the Lintmarsh baseline file before tagging. Do not hand-edit it; run the `baseline-sync` task and commit the result. New findings since last release must be triaged or suppressed with a reason — no silent additions. If the baseline shrinks, great, note it in the changelog. Verify CI passes with the fresh baseline on the release branch. Record the verification token below.

build token for kagaf-hahof: htk14_9d3d4d26d7d8de

## Authentication

The Plovermark address autocomplete widget requires a bearer token on every suggestion request. Tokens are scoped per deployment and rotate at release cut. Release managers must verify the staging token before tagging. Requests without a valid token return 401 with no body. Use the staging credential below.

session JWT of yawep-yawep = eyJhbGciOiJIUzI1NiIsInR5cCI6IkpXVCJ9.eyJzdWIiOiI3pWF3_In0.aXYsHiog

## Runbook: BannerBloom consent rollout

When promoting a new BannerBloom consent-banner version, first verify the geo-ruleset hash matches the approved release, then enable the canary at 5% for two hours. Watch the opt-out rate dashboard; anything above baseline plus 2% means rollback. Reviewers should confirm the deployed flags against this page. The expected rollout configuration is as follows.

service settings:
[casax]
port = 6379
team = rusir
host = casax.zemvarhq.corp
region = outer-4
access_code = ac_9808ce
timeout_ms = 1500

## Step 4: Update the cutoff rule

Crumbwise is replacing the old midnight order-cutoff with a per-store rule. After migration, each bakery location sets its own cutoff time, and orders past it roll to the next baking day. Support should no longer advise customers of a single global deadline. Apply the new rule by loading the updated configuration values shown below.

deployment values, kajep-kageg:
[praix]
host = praix.paliqcorp.corp
user = praix_svc
database = praix_prod